It is important to identify the type of lock on your door before you begin the replacement process. This will allow you to locate a replacement. Some of the most commonly used kinds are Avocet and Fulltex, Gu Ferco, Mila, and Yale locks.
It is possible to fix a faulty cylinder lock without replacing it completely. The most frequent issue is the barrel bolt breaking that holds the lock in position. The solution is to unhook the handle and locate the screw that is holding the lock cylinder. Once you find it, unscrew the screw and store it in a safe place.
You can also grease your cylinder to ensure smooth operation. You should clean the hinges on the internal of the mechanism with an abrasive cloth and apply a dry lubricant to the cylinder every six months. Use a graphite or PTFE fluid instead of an oil-based lubricant. This will draw dirt over time.
Another issue that is common to upvc door locks that can be repaired at home is a broken barrel of the lock. This is usually caused by repeated attempts to open the door with keys. It can also happen if you hit, kick or smash the door. It is important to replace the cylinder with one that can be able to withstand a burglary attempt. This can be done by using a security-approved cylinder.

Handle
No matter if your french door lock replacement is regular upvc door or a composite door replacement lock one, it's likely to have a euro multi-point lock installed. These locks have a unique cylinder that is not able to be misinterpreted for any other lock. They're only compatible with doors that have these types.
When you replace the handle on your door made of pvc, you must ensure that the new handle is the correct size for your door. This includes the fixing centers key-hole, lever and fixing centre dimensions. It can be difficult to determine unless you are very familiar with the door handles made of upvc or have access to the original one to measure from. You can find the dimensions for your Upvc handle by measuring from the center of the key hole, to the centres of the two screws, and replacing upvc door locks the lever length on the inside of the door. These measurements can be input into the upvc door handle dimensions matrix to find the correct replacement.
Over time, the handles of upvc doors are prone to becoming floppy and loose. This can be quite a hassle as it means the handle is no longer able to be used. You can do several things to avoid this. First of all, a little lubrication can go a great way to keeping your door lock mechanisms functioning properly.
If your handle remains loose after this, it could be because the spindle is not properly seated in the barrel of lock. It is essential that the spindle is seated properly in the barrel. If the barrel of the lock is not in the proper position this can cause many issues, including jamming and locking issues. Key
If a upvc replacement door locks door lock becomes jammed, there's a high chance that it's time for a replacement. You can replace lock in upvc door an upvc lock without the assistance of having a locksmith. It's also a task you can do yourself if you have the proper tools. Anyone with a bit of confidence and basic DIY skills can modify a uPVC cylinder.
A door lock made of upvc comprises two main parts comprising a cylinder as well as a handle set. The cylinder is housed within the frame and is controlled by a key that can be operated from both the outside and inside (though often only from the inside due to fire safety reasons). When the key is put into the frame a series or hooks or bolts are engaged at different locations. This improves security and increases the efficiency of the door by forming a tight seal against drafts.
There are many signs that your door lock is in need of replacement difficulties in inserting or turning the key and visible damage to the mechanism and regular problems with the latch function.
